Address

3Psf878rtk4bpBGAEcU1f2apx4iPrbCkMf

0 BTC

Confirmed
Total Received0.0037955 BTC
Total Sent0.0037955 BTC
Final Balance0 BTC
No. Transactions2

Transactions

3Psf878rtk4bpBGAEcU1f2apx4iPrbCkMf0.0037955 BTC